IADB agrees to resume lending to Honduras

WASHINGTON, March 16 | Tue Mar 16, 2010 12:05pm EDT

WASHINGTON, March 16 (Reuters) - Inter-American Development Bank member countries on Tuesday agreed to resume lending to Honduras, the latest development institution to recognize the new government of President Porfirio Lobo.

"In a meeting today the board decided to resume lending to Honduras," a spokesman for the regional development bank said. (Reporting by Lesley Wroughton; Editing by James Dalgleish)
